Send your followers ahead of you to draw out enemies. Just use them as pawns and its pretty fun. Striders are a pain, but you can shoot a rocket, then hide behind cover and safety direct it to the strider. Its a hard chapter, but valve rewards you by making you super OP for the final chapter.
